Paternity Leave
Leave for fathers and non-birthing parents after a child's birth or adoption.
Definition
Paternity leave is time off for fathers and non-birthing parents to bond with a new child. Under FMLA, fathers have the same right to bonding leave as mothers. Many companies now offer equal parental leave regardless of gender to support all parents and promote equity.
